Output 43654290c0559ea50833a69f39fc046310428e2d6a3c406168226d09edd67ba3:4

value
239990000
script pubkey
OP_0 OP_PUSHBYTES_20 87e9301f76571243743ce72f17a57f3bc2e67d6e
address
ltc1qsl5nq8mk2ufyxapuuuh30ftl80pwvltwqxnzzr
transaction
43654290c0559ea50833a69f39fc046310428e2d6a3c406168226d09edd67ba3
spent
true